My invention relates to smokers pipes, and has for its main object to provide a pipe for smoking tobacco which will eliminate certain well known drawbacks of the present pipes.
As it is known, the smokers pipes used to-day, have a bowl which is lled with tobacco, the top of the tobacco is ignited, and the filling gradually smoked. It is obvious that in this manner, the smoke has to pass through all the tobacco yet unconsumed and laying underneath the burning region or strata, and it is also well known that the smoke passing through the yet unconsumed tobacco will deposit various harmful materials, vapors, etc., so that the tobacco will become wet, soggy, Saturated with various materials, and when burned in such a condition, it will produce an unpleasant and even harmful smoke, and, certainly, the tobacco so contaminated and then smoked, will lose its original fresh taste and aroma.
My invention aims to provide means in a smokers pipe whereby the tobacco will be burned and consumed in successive layers or strata, and the smoke from each layer or region will be directly drawn into and through the stem of the pipe without rst passing through the unconsumed portion of the tobacco. I am aware of the fact that many devices have been proposed for such a purpose, but, to my knowledge, experience and information, none of these devices Were practical, efcient, and desirable, and none of them found their way into actual practice and use.
The main purpose of my invention is to provide a pipe for smoking tobacco, in which the tobacco will be consumed in successive layers, in any desired number, or plurality of stages, without the smoke ever passing through the unconsumed part of the tobacco.
Another object of my invention is to provide means whereby the smoking of the tobacco may be stopped at any stage of the consumption thereof, and the pipe caused to automatically stop operating.
Still a further object of my invention is to provide a smokers pipe, as characterized hereinbefore, in which the smoke will have to pass through quite a complicated devious way, where it will have a chance and means for depositing condensates, vapors, and other harmful ingredients, and wherein it may also be cooled.
Still further objects of my invention will be apparent as the specification of the same proceeds, and, among others, I may mention: to provide a device of the character indicated, which will be simple in construction, easy to operate La and use, will be applicable to pipes used at present, and which may be conveniently removed from the pipe, the same being adapted to be disassembled, cleaned, and just as easily and conveniently replaced into the pipe.
With the above objects in view, my device mainly consists in an upstanding tube placed into the bowl of the pipe, being open at the top, so that the smoke of the burning tobacco may be drawn through the tube without touching the rest of the tobacco underneath the burning region, said tube being slidable downwardly, and thereby causing gradual layers or strata of the tobacco to be burned.
In addition, said tube may be arranged in a self containing unit, easily applied to any pipe, or removed therefrom in order to take apart and clean the same, and just as easily assembled and returned into the pipe, means being provided in said device containing said tube, whereby the smoke is caused to pass through a complicated passageway, which possibly may include receivers or containers for condensates or other deposits, and for cooling the smoke.

Referring now to the drawings more in detail by characters of reference, the numeral I0 indicates my novel pipe, in general, having a bowl I l, and the stem l2, and, obviously, made of any appropriate material, like wood.
The bowl and stem of the pipe may be of any design and construction, entirely as it is usual now, so that my pipe not only may be newly manufactured, but any old pipe may be changed to my novel construction, as will be obvious from the description herein to follow.
In exercising my invention, a screw threaded bore I3 will be made through the bottom of the bowl ll of the pipe shown in Figs. l, 2 and 3, and a screw threaded plug l@ secured therein by the cooperation of their threads, said plug preferably being made of metal, but it can be made of any other appropriate material, as will 3 be obvious. A central sleeve I5 is provided .in the plug member I4, having the aperture or opening I6 therethrough, and a tube or pipe I1, also preferably made of metal, may be pushed into the upper end of said opening I6, the major portion of said tube I1 projecting upwardly in the center of the pipe bowl II. Tube I1 may be closed at the top I8 and said top may be conical, as indicated in Fig.Y 1. Aperturas or smoke inlet holes I 9 are provided around the 'tube I1 near its top.

Figsgefand 5 I'-fs'how another embodiment o't my ation. fIn th embodiment, alsoj'the resen'ts they pipe, in general', hav- A plug 40, generally similar to the plug I4, described in the earlier embodiment, may be secured in a bore 4l in the bottom of the bowl, by any appropriate method, as by the screw 4threads 42.
The plug 45, in this case also, may have a depending hollow cylindrical portion 43 with exterior screw threads 44 on which may be secured a cooling and condensation receiving container 45, as by the interior screw threads 45 at its top portion. The plug 4t may have a similar smoke exit opening 39 as described hereinbefore communicating with the bore 29.
In this embodiment, my invention includes a tube or pipe 41 having a preferably conical pointed closed top 48, and a plurality of openings 49, for drawing the smoke from the burning tobacco into the tube, as has been described hereinbefore. The tube may slide upwardly or downwardly, in a sealing manner, in an aperture 55 in the plug 40, and its lower` portion 5l will extend into the space within the hollow plug Aid and the container 45.
A disk 52 may be secured on the lower portion 5I of the tube 4l, said disk having exterior screw threads 53. A wider tube or hollow cylinder 54 may rise from the bottom of the container 45, having the interior screw threads 55 meshing with the screw threads on the disk 52.
A rotatable member 53 may be arranged in the bottom of the container 45, having a knurled operating disk portion 5l, by which it may be rotated, as will be obvious. 'Iwo upstanding rods 58 are secured on the member 55 passing through appropriate holes 55 in the disk 52.
It will be seen that when the knurled knob 51 is rotated in an appropriate direction, it will rotate the disk 52 in the same direction, whereby the disk will move downwardly, as indicated by the arrow Sii, through the operation of the screw threads 53 and 55, and will draw the tube 41 in a downward direction to a desired extent.
The smoke will enter through the apertures 49, as indicated by the arrows 6l, will pass downwardly through the tube 41 into the wider tube o1' hollow cylinder 54, from which it will exit into the container l5 through a plurality of openings or apertures 62, as indicated by arrows 63, after which the smoke will nd its way to the exit opening 30 (arrow 54).
In this embodiment, obviously, the tube 4-1 may be made much narrower than the outer tube I in the earlier modiiication. It also will be obvious that a pipe constructed according to said second modification will be easily taken apart and again assembled, similarly as described in connection with the iirst form of my invention.
In the rst embodiment of my invention, at 15, (Figs. 1 and 3), a pin and slot engagement is shown between the pipe Il and the plug I4, whereby rotation of the pipe is prevented, as will be obvious.
In the second modication, Figs. 4 and 5, the numeral 'll indicates two downwardly projecting pins on the bottom of the disk 52. The purpose of these pins is to provide a limit for the downward movement of the disk whereby the disk must stop at a predetermined distance above the rotating member 56 in the lowest position, so that even in that position, free passage is provided for the smoke to exit through the opening 63.
